Fabric with recycled fibers

Features

Fabric that contains fibers recycled from the PET bottles and other wastes collected in the riverside and seaside cleanup campaign. Durability of the band made of this material is kept equivalent to the normal synthetic leather band but the wear comfort is softer. UpDRIFT™*, a project operated by JEPLAN and TOSHIMA aiming for taking measures of marine debris supported the development of this material.
*UpDRIFT™: A project to change wastes such as PET bottles collected in the riverside and seaside cleanup campaign into resources and products with reduced environmental burdens.

Handling

• Wear this kind of band rather loosen to allow ventilation.
• Take care not to adhere volatile chemicals, bleaches, alcoholic chemicals such as cosmetics and detergents. Also take care not to expose the band to strong ultraviolet ray such as direct sunlight for a long time to avoid discoloration and deformation.

Caring

When the band is wet with water or perspiration, immediately remove the wet with soft and dry cloth without rubbing.

 

Knit (ECOPET® is partly used)

Features

The material that “ECOPET®*”, a polyester fiber made from collected PET bottles and clothes is partly used.
*Polyester fiber made out of collected PET bottles and clothes utilizing a recycling technology. CO2 emissions can be reduced more compared to those made from petroleum. It has the flexible and soft characteristics.

Handling

• Due to the characteristics of the material, knit products may split between the nets or the stitches may be unequal when excessively pressed or pulled.
• When the band touches materials such as alcohol and cosmetics, it may become discolored or may start smelling.
• When left wet, the band may become disclosed or worn. Depending on the band, avoid using it in a bath, for swimming and/or wet work even if the watch itself is waterproof.

Caring

• Soak the band in water and clean it softly by hands.
• After cleaning, pull it into shape and then put it in the airy place out of the sun to dry.
• When using detergent, use a neutral one and avoid putting undiluted solution. It may cause the color unevenness.

 

Piñatex®

Features

Natural and innovative fabric made from the pineapple leaf fiber, which is a byproduct of pineapple farmers. The biomass left after removing the fibers from leaves can be used as a nutrient rich natural fertilizer and biofuel. There is no waste for the production of “Piñatex®*”.
* Piñatex® is a trade mark of Ananas Anam UK Limited.

Handling

• Because it is natural, aging including abrasion, deformation, and/or discoloration cannot be avoided. Replace it occasionally.
• Wear this kind of band rather loosen to allow ventilation.
• Take care not to adhere volatile chemicals, bleaches, alcoholic chemicals such as cosmetics and detergents.

Caring

When the band is wet with water or perspiration, immediately remove the wet with soft and dry cloth without rubbing.

 

Apple Leather

Features

The material made from the apples’ leftovers including skins and residues as a replacement of natural leather characterized with its smooth texture. It is an environmentally-friendly, anti-animal material that can not only reduce environmental load when processing wastes but also reduce the content of resin derived from petroleum.

Handling

• Because it is natural, aging including abrasion, deformation, and/or discoloration cannot be avoided. Replace it occasionally.
• Wear this kind of band rather loosen to allow ventilation.
• Take care not to adhere volatile chemicals, bleaches, alcoholic chemicals such as cosmetics and detergents. Also take care not to expose the band to strong ultraviolet ray such as direct sunlight for a long time to avoid discoloration and deformation.

Caring

When the band is wet with water or perspiration, immediately remove the wet with soft and dry cloth without rubbing.

 

Bridle Leather

Features

Strong and durable leather made by soaking the rawhide in tannin pits for several months and then fully waxed between its fibers.

Handling

• Take care not to adhere bleaches, alcoholic chemicals such as cosmetics and detergents. It may cause discoloration.
• Due to the characteristics of the leather, white powders called “bloom” may appear on the leather surface. The bloom is caused by the natural waxes and oils rising to the surface.

Caring

When the band is wet with water or perspiration, immediately remove the wet with soft and dry cloth without rubbing. Using the soft cloth, wipe the bloom off lightly in parallel to the line where the bloom appears.
